This icon was designed in 1928 by Le Corbusier, Pierre Jeanneret & Charlotte Perriand.
They placed the individual at the center of their design and created the perfect balance between
design purity and user comfort.
In 1974 Cassina started producing an all-black version of de LC4; black structure, recliner and upholstery.
Our model is from the mid 1980's.
